442 Deputy Ciarán Lynch asked the Minister for Education and Science the cost to his Department, in each year since its introduction, of implementing the provisions of the Official Languages Act 2003;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[3408/09]

View answer

Written answers

Since the implementation of the provisions of the Official Languages Act 2003 relating to the translation of publications the following are the costs incurred by my Department: 2007 — €181,322.31; 2008 — €156,060.40.

Prior to 2007 the amount spent on the Irish translation of publications was not separately identified and accordingly my Department is unable to provide this information.

There may be additional costs that have been incurred by various sections of my Department with regard to implementing the provisions of the Act. These costs have been from within existing allocations and are not readily identifiable.

In addition, Section 31 of the Education Act 1998 obliges the Minister to establish a body to provide supports to schools for the teaching and learning of Irish and through Irish. Accordingly, my Department provides a range of services and supports through Irish.
